Techniques for Observing Normal Child Behavior

A handbook of standard techniques for observing children's behavior in nursery school settings -- it is also applicable to children in club groups, elementary school classrooms, and hospitals.

Nancy Carbonara was a child psychologist in Pittsburgh and practiced in Mt. Lebanon, Pennsylvania for many years before her retirement in 2013.
